Jalandhar, Nov 11 (UNI) The Punjab and Sindh Bank (PSB) defeated promising Sports Authority of India (SAI) by 3-1 in the 23rd Indian Oil Surjit Hockey Tournament here today while Police beat Air India Mumbai by 4-1.

In Women's section, Central Railway, Northen Railway, Pepsu XI and Chandigarh XI have made their way into the semi-finals. While Central Railway, Mumbai beat the Railway Coach Factory (RCF) Kapurthala by 3-1, Northern Railway shared points with Western Railway (1-1) in their last respective league matches played at the Burlton Park Surjit Hockey Stadium.

The Men's section super league round match between the P&S Bank and the SAI team produced classic Indian hockey with both teams playing well. However, the experienced bankmen defended well to avert frequent assaults made by young energised SAI players and also clinched opportunities to score as and when the same came in their way.

The star studded bank team began an offensive note with a field move bringing them penalty corner in the 3rd minute itself. However, SAI goal keeper Amaanulla averted goal with good save. In the 19th minute Kulwinder Singh made an advancement and scored first goal for the bankmen.

This lead prevailed till dying moments and in the meantime both teams made a number of moves against each other but defenders gave no chance for a goal. In 63rd minute bankmen scored their second goal through penalty corner shot by Sharanjit Singh and 67 minute, the winning team made another move and this time too Kulwinder Singh broke into SAI defence to sound the board (3-0). A minute before the closure SAI retaliated with Captain Yudhvir Singh reducing the margin with a spectacular field goal (1-3).
